People Score in 14478, Keuka Park, New York

The People Score for the Prostate Cancer Score in 14478, Keuka Park, New York is 86 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

An estimate of 96.73 percent of the residents in 14478 has some form of health insurance. 26.39 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 83.89 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 14478 would have to travel an average of 7.07 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Soldiers And Sailors Memorial Hospital Of Yates. In a 20-mile radius, there are 179 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 14478, Keuka Park, New York.

**The Prostate Cancer Score: A Multifaceted Assessment**

A "prostate cancer score" isn't a single number, but rather a composite of factors that influence the risk and outcomes of the disease within a community. In Keuka Park, several key elements shape this score:

* **Age and Demographics:** As mentioned, the older demographic in Keuka Park is a significant factor. Prostate cancer is primarily a disease of older men. The higher the proportion of men over 60, the higher the potential risk.
* **Access to Healthcare:** This is a critical piece of the puzzle. Keuka Park is relatively close to the larger towns of Penn Yan and Hammondsport, which offer access to primary care physicians, specialists, and diagnostic facilities. The proximity to these resources is a positive factor, allowing for early detection and treatment. However, transportation can be a challenge for some residents, particularly those with mobility issues.
* **Screening Rates:** Regular prostate cancer screening, including PSA (prostate-specific antigen) tests, is crucial for early detection. This is where community awareness and education play a vital role. Are local physicians actively promoting screening? Are there community initiatives to encourage men to get tested? The answer to these questions directly impacts the score.
* **Healthy Lifestyle:** This is where Keuka Park has a significant opportunity to shine. A healthy lifestyle, including a balanced diet, regular exercise, and avoiding tobacco, is a cornerstone of prostate health. The community's access to outdoor recreation, fresh produce from local farms, and a generally lower-stress environment are all positive influences.
* **Local Wellness Programs:** The availability of programs focused on men's health, fitness, and nutrition is another key element. Does Keuka Park have any specific initiatives targeting prostate health, such as support groups, educational workshops, or free screening events?
* **Neighborhood Vibe and Social Support:** The feeling of community, the level of social support, and the overall sense of well-being contribute significantly to health outcomes. A strong community fosters a sense of connection and encourages individuals to prioritize their health.
* **Environmental Factors:** While not as directly impactful as lifestyle choices, environmental factors can play a role. Exposure to certain pollutants or toxins could potentially increase risk. The relatively clean environment of Keuka Park is a positive factor in this regard.
